About this facility
Hillsboro Rehab & Hcc is a Medicare and Medicaid certified nursing home in Hillsboro, Montgomery County, Illinois, first approved in 1984. The facility is certified for 121 beds and serves an average of 84.9 residents. It is operated as a for-profit corporation and is part of the Tutera Senior Living & Health Care chain, which includes 25 facilities with an average CMS rating of 2.0 stars.
According to CMS Care Compare data, Hillsboro Rehab & Hcc holds an overall rating of 1 out of 5 stars, which is below the Illinois state average of 2.55 stars. Its component ratings are also low: 1 star for health inspections, 1 star for quality measures, and 1 star for staffing.
Nurse staffing levels total 3.02 hours per resident per day, including 0.41 RN hours per resident per day. Nursing staff turnover is reported at 60.8%.
On penalties, CMS records show 2 federal fines totaling $252,737.00, and 1 payment denial has been issued against this facility.
CMS displays its abuse warning icon for this facility. Families should review the facility's inspection record directly on Medicare Care Compare for details on the underlying findings.
Ownership has not changed in the past 12 months according to CMS records. This profile is based on CMS Care Compare data; consult Care Compare directly for the most current vintage of this information.
